Condensation Polymerization (Nylon 6,6)
nH2N(CH2)6NH2 + nHOOC(CH2)4COOH → nylon 6,6 + nH2O
نظرة عامة
Hexamethylenediamine reacts with adipic acid to form nylon 6,6 through condensation polymerization, releasing water. Each amide bond formed links the monomers into a long chain. The nylon rope trick demonstration draws a continuous nylon thread from the interface of two immiscible solutions.

الأهمية الصناعية
Nylon 6,6 is used in textiles, carpets, automotive parts, and engineering plastics. Over 3 million tonnes are produced annually.
